Frequently Asked Questions about Redmond
How much are Studio apartments in Redmond?
There are currently 112 Studio Apartments in Redmond with rent ranges from $999 to $3,070 with an average price of $1,969.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Redmond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Redmond ranges from $1,114 to $6,158 with an average monthly rent of $2,706.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Redmond c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Redmond range from $1,524 to $7,587.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,565.
How expensive are Redmond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 101 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Redmond on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,740 to $10,087 - averaging $4,488 for the location.
